Gold Coast Marathon Race Weekend at a Glance
Before planning your shakeouts, recovery sessions and celebrations, here are the official race start times for the weekend. The start and finish lines for all races are located at the Gold Coast Marathon Race Precinct at Broadwater Parklands, Southport.
Saturday, 4th July
6:15 am – China Airlines Half Marathon
9:15 am – Gold Coast Recreation and Sport Wheelchair 10km
9:25 am – Southern Cross University 10km Run
11:10 am – Australia Fair 2km Junior Dash, Boys
11:20 am – Australia Fair 2km Junior Dash, Girls
11:22 am – Australia Fair 2km Junior Dash, Juniors with parents or guardians
11:30 am – Gold Coast Recreation and Sport Wheelchair 5km
11:45 am – Gold Coast Airport 5km
Sunday, 5th July
6:05 am – Gold Coast Recreation and Sport Wheelchair Marathon
6:15 am – ASICS Gold Coast Marathon
ASICS Gold Coast Marathon wave starts
6:15 am – Seeded, Priority and Start Zone A
6:25 am – Start Zone B
6:35 am – Start Zone C
6:45 am – Start Zones D and E
Runners should check their official participant information for recommended arrival times, start zones, transport details and any final race-week updates.

Plan Your Gold Coast Marathon Week
With so many events happening across Broadbeach, Burleigh Heads, Mermaid Beach, Nobby Beach and Southport, it’s worth planning your schedule before the weekend begins!
Some Friday-morning shakeouts overlap, and travel may take longer than usual due to race-week traffic and road closures.


Register early, double-check meeting locations and leave yourself enough time to arrive without adding unnecessary stress to your race preparation.
Most importantly, choose the activations that will add to your weekend, not leave you standing on the start line already exhausted.
